Abstract

PURPOSE: To establish the small sized A/D converter, by connecting the cpacitor of capacitance 2C in series with a plurality of comparing voltage storage capacitors of capacitance C, applying reference voltage to the first stage, and producing the comparison voltage after the first stage.
CONSTITUTION: The capacitors C21 to C23 of capacitance 2C are connected un series with the comparison voltage storage capacitors C11 to C13 of capacitance C. The reference voltage VREF is fed to the first stage circuit of C11 and C21, and the stage after the first stage is connected to the storage capacitor of the prestage via the switches S1 and S2, and the final stage is connected with the capacitor C3 of capacitance C via the switches S3, then at the terminal of C11 to C13, 1/2i of the reference voltage (where: i=1∼3) is obtained. Next, the input voltage VIN is held at the capacitor C0 of the capacitance C and it is inputted to the comparator COM with the combination of the switch group I, G1 to G3, B1 to B3. Thus, the bit coefficient bi of each bit represented in VIN=Σbi/2i×VREF between the input voltage and the reference voltage is sequentially determined. Thus, two types of capacitors can be used and the A/D converter in small size and high speed can be obtained.
